The Fundamentals of Alcohol: Recognizing the Categories
Although numerous individuals appreciate cocktails, comprehending the different groups of alcohol is important for crafting an exceptional drink. Alcohol can be broadly identified into numerous main classifications: spirits, liqueurs, and strengthened red wines. Spirits, the structure of many alcoholic drinks, include scotch, vodka, gin, tequila, and rum. Each spirit carries special characteristics stemmed from its ingredients and distillation process.Liqueurs, on the various other hand, are sweetened spirits infused with flavors from seasonings, fruits, and natural herbs, often working as modifiers in mixed drinks. Fortified white wines, such as vermouth and sherry, are red wines that have been improved with distilled spirits, giving complexity and depth to numerous mixes.Understanding these categories enables mixed drink lovers to make educated selections, leading to well balanced and harmonious blends. Rum: A Sweet Retreat to Exotic Cocktails
Rum, typically associated with exotic escapes and sun-soaked coastlines, brings a flexible and wonderful character to cocktails. This spirit, derived from sugarcane or molasses, varies in flavor accounts and shades, varying from light and crisp to dark and abundant. Light rum normally acts as a structure for invigorating mixed drinks such as the classic Mojito and Daiquiri, while dark rum adds deepness to beverages like the Rainy 'n' dark or Rum Punch.Additionally, spiced rum presents a hint of heat and intricacy, making it a popular choice for innovative concoctions. The versatility of rum allows it to blend seamlessly with fruit mixers, syrups, and juices, providing to different palates. Frequently Asked Questions
What Are the Alcohol Material Levels for Various Kinds Of Liquor?
The alcohol material levels of various kinds of alcohol differ significantly. Usually, spirits like vodka and whiskey contain about 40% alcohol by volume (ABV), while liqueurs normally vary from 15% to 30% ABV.
Just how Should I Shop Numerous Alcohols for Optimum Quality?
To keep perfect quality, liquors must be kept upright in a cool, dark place, away from sunshine and warmth. Secured bottles last longer, while opened up ones gain from refrigeration, particularly for cream-based or flavored ranges.
